results the interobserver agreement for sonographic descriptors changed between fair and substantial. the highest agreement was detected for mass orientation (κ=0.66). the lowest agreement was found in the margin (κ=0.33). the interobserver agreement for bi-rads final category was found as fair (κ=0.35). the intraobserver agreement for sonographic descriptors changed between substantial and alm...

PURPOSE We compared strain ratio vs. qualitative elastography for the further differentiation of focal breast lesions, with special focus on limiting factors. MATERIALS AND METHODS 215 patients with 224 histologically proven breast masses (116 malignant, 108 benign) were prospectively examined using a high-end ultrasound system (Philips iU22) with serial elastography function.
